High Schools in Berkshire Hills


Summary:

The Berkshire Hills region of Massachusetts is home to a single high school, Monument Mt Regional High, which serves students in grades 9-12. While the school has seen a decline in its statewide ranking and SchoolDigger rating in recent years, it continues to provide education to the local community.

Monument Mt Regional High's academic performance is mixed, with proficiency rates in core subjects like English Language Arts, Mathematics, and Science falling below the state averages. However, the school's performance in Biology is stronger, with proficiency rates exceeding the state average. The school's 4-year graduation rate of 85.0% is slightly below the state average, while its dropout rate of 5.3% is higher than the state average.

Despite the school's declining performance, it remains well-resourced, with a student-teacher ratio of 9.3 and per-student spending of $23,375, which is higher than the state average.
